How apartment prices evolved at the beginning of 2026. “The situation can get even more complicated!”


Article by Corina Vârlan – Published on Wednesday, 01 April 2026, 16:36 / Updated on Wednesday, 01 April 2026 16:38

New apartment prices rose slowly over the past month in the country's major cities, while older homes remained broadly flat. Bucharest, Iași and Timișoara stand out with a more pronounced growth rate, according to Indicelui Imobiliare.ro.

  • The average price requested by owners and developers at the national level for the apartments put up for sale exceeded, for the first time, in March 2026, the threshold of 2,000 euros/useful square meter.

  • Cluj-Napoca is reaching new records, but other large cities in the country are recovering more and more from the price differences recorded in recent years.

  • A tendency to slow down the pace of growth recorded at the level of apartment prices can be observed in Brașov and Constanța.

  • The biggest price increases in the last year were in the case of old apartments in Bucharest (14%), Constanța (11%) and Timișoara (10%).

  • The cheapest old apartments you can buy in one of the big cities in the country can be found in Timișoara. At the opposite pole is Cluj-Napoca.

The evolution of apartment prices in Bucharest

The average price of new apartments in Bucharest rose in March to 2,541 euros/sq.mby almost 2% over February and by 24% more than in the same period last year — the biggest increase among big cities, according to Indicelui Imobiliare.ro. In the old buildings, the average price reached 2,212 euros/sqm, up 14% compared to March last year.

New records are being reached in Cluj-Napoca

In the segment of new apartments, in March the threshold of 3,400 euros/sq.mbut the increase compared to February is small, below 1%. The local market is visibly slowing down: prices are 7% higher than in March last year, compared to a 13% advance in the previous similar period. According to the Imobiliare.ro Index, old homes had a slightly faster evolution: prices increased by 1% in the last month and by 8% compared to March 2025, reaching 3,290 euros/m2.

Brașov: braking in the evolution of prices

New apartments in Brașov are sold at an average price of 2,723 euros/useful square meterafter a 1% advance in the last month. Compared to the beginning of last spring prices were increased by only 9% compared to 18% in the previous similar period. A similar trend is registered in the old market. Homes in old blocks are put up for sale at an average price of 2,222 euros/useful square meter, close to the price in Bucharest.

Constanta, another atypical market

A slowdown in the growth rate of new apartment prices could also be observed in Constanța, where the market is influenced by investor interest in locally available properties. Moreover, in the city on the shore of the Black Sea, prices advanced the least in the last 12 months, by only 4%, up to 2,096 euros/useful square meter. The average asking price for old homes in Constanța reached 1,964 euros/useful square meter until the end of last month. The owners made the apartments more expensive than the developers, more precisely by about 11% in 12 months.

The average price of new apartments in Iasi reaches 2,042 euros/sqm

The Ieșan market is one of the most dynamic, recording according to the Imobiliare.ro Index a 15% advance in prices in 12 months, the second highest after the one observed in Bucharest. This evolution is influenced by changes in supply. Real estate developers continue to expand large-scale projects and put new units up for sale at a higher average price than two years ago. In March 2024, new apartments in Iasi could be bought for 1,629 euros/useful square meter.

The old apartments remain, however, some of the cheapest available in the country's major cities. The average price requested by the owners is 1,941 euros/useful square meter, stagnating in the last month, according to a release from Imobiliare.ro.

In Timișoara, a sharp tendency to increase prices is observed

Prices are advancing rapidly in the new segment of the residential market and in Timișoara. During the last month, an average of 2,189 euros/useful square meter, after an advance that slightly exceeded 2% compared to February, the most consistent recorded by Indicele Imobiliare.ro among the major urban centers monitored. In one year, buyers ended up paying 12% more to make a real estate purchase in a new block.

This trend can be explained by the growing number of real estate developers who see the potential of the city on Bega and are launching modern projects here, with an increasingly important share of premium units on offer. The old apartments in Timișoara, on the other hand, remain the cheapest available to buyers in the country's big cities. The average asking price last month was 1,875 euros/useful square meter.

“At the moment, there is an obvious difference between the expectations of buyers and those of developers. In the short term, the situation may become even more complicated due to the effects of the Gulf War on construction costs. It is no coincidence that the most dynamic markets are actually the most affordable in terms of income: Timișoara, Bucharest, Iași. Contrary to expectations, prices are not falling, because a balance is maintained between supply and demand in the market. In the construction sites we see today they build the apartments that are mostly already contracted”, said Daniel Crainic, Imobiliare.ro marketing director.

The evolution of apartment prices in secondary residential markets

The average asking price for apartments put up for sale in Craiova, regardless of their age, increased by 1% in the last month, reaching 2,178 euros/useful square meter. Buyers are paying 16% more than a year ago to make a real estate purchase.

The apartments in Sibiu are on the market with an average price of 1,977 euros/useful square meter. Over the past month, prices have largely stagnated. However, they remain 10% higher than at the beginning of last spring.

In Oradea, the average asking price for apartments listed for sale reaches, according to the Imobiliare.ro Index, 1,826 euros/useful square meter, after an advance of about 1% in the last month and 7% in the last year.

Even if there were no major changes on the local residential market during March, apartments in Ploiești are significantly more expensive than a year ago. Buyers pay 12% more for every square meter of their future homes. The average requested price reached 1,361 euros/useful square meter.
